apneic

[ ap-nee-ik ]

adjective
  1. of or relating to apnea, a condition in which a person, either an infant or a sleeping adult, involuntarily and temporarily stops breathing: In apneic patients, the muscles of the tongue or soft palate may relax too much and collapse against the back of the throat, blocking airflow.
